'The Wowing letter wan written by a loan(
gentleman of this city, who went with a arnall
party of emigrants, from Cincinnati, and is consid
erably in advance duos Pittsburgh Company.
Fear Creams, June 15th.
We arrived at this place some time ago, and art
all in good health. We have been travelling
along the North Fork of the Platte aid. I last
Wrote to you, aad I must any, for myself, that I
have never spent a more agreeable or pleasant
time in my life. The valley along this branch of
the river is one of great beauty, sod the scenery
more vaned than in the United States. We hove
' hitherto found the grass good and plenty, and OUT
animals are in hoe condition, and from all apps.'•
maces, will stand the tourney to the gold regions
remarkably well.
have had several exciting toofato hunts Banc
I last wrote you, and killed three, and one ante
lope. There are high bluffs, or mounteans of whit
clay extending along this valley for a conwderab
'distance, which wear quite • singular aspect:
The peaks are front two to three hundred fe
high, and separated from each other by beautil
ravines, covered with 6arcata of red ceder. Rack
of the blue, the country is rolling and lolly as far
as the eye can see.
Otte lovely spot which we passed through a short
time ago, is called Ash Hollow, and contains about
~:,
thi y acres of ground covered with tab, wild ,
µI trees, black currant bushes, and various oth
lu aof shrubbery. I plucked a quantity of the
mr ants, and they made an excellent stew. Wild
roses also bloom herd in such quantities as to
make the whole country look like • garden.
The next place of note la Castle bluffs, no called
because by a little stretch of the Imagtustion you
can convert as lolly peaks ram castles, cathedral',
mosques, or indeed almost any other building. —
This curious feature to the scenery, continues for
about one hundred miles. The -Court House" is
a singular rock, in appearance, almost exactly like
the one in Pittsburgh, and stands upon a high
ouund. Another singular looking structure is
'chimney rock" which also Mande on a mound,
and is about 230 feet high, and to shape nearly
round. I suppose it is unoot 23 feet in diameter,
and though but a mass of hard white clay, it with
stands all lands of weather. I climbed to the
succeed of Scout. Bluffs, and had a tine view of
the Rocky Mountains and Latinate's. Peak, about
150 miles distant. True peak In 1300 feet in alti
tude. The road near the bluffs is generally sandy,
and pretty good. We have found grass and wa
ter plenty, and have bad to endure the -.molten
pelting." of some had worms, of which you can
have but little idea, mince the hail atOneS are much
larger than at home. Same of our cattle and hor
ses LWve been lost, owing to their running of in
affright ashen struck by these frozen manes or wa
ter,and no person can with safety stand out from the
shelter ol the witgons. We have last one wagon,
which wen stench by beaming, and with all its
oontents, burned up.
Fart Laramie is a tradsng point between the
whites and Indians, and formerly belonged to I
fur company, but haa been purchased by the Con
ted States. It is situated Upon the west bank 0
the Laramie neer, which is about forty feet wide
and faur feet deep.
The fart end all n.e gulp:tinter budding, are built
°firm dned bneks:sush as the Men ream wseyvhich
are called "adobois" and make a very substhadel
but:ding.
We leave here to day, and will go by way of
Fort Hatt. A few hewn ago, I mot Mr. Wm. M.
rid several other Pittaburgbers, who are all in
good health.
The emigrants are becoming more and mare en,
cited as they approach nearer and nearer to Calls
(orate, and nap) , are abandoning their wagons.
and packtog through. Cantata Antrum's; com
pany a akrout ten days behind me. lies mules
base almost all given out, and lee finds peat dlf
acuity in getting along. The wagons of the Yams
burghers ere all too heavy, and cumbersome. I
will write by the first opts:mum. till when. La
tely e me Years,
Ct.., pc —Mr. W. P. Gunning, the confidential
clerk and book keeper of Meese. Lyon. Short, ie
conamoied suicide yesterday by banging him
srlt by a quilt, twieted like a rope, to his bed pus/
The body when found was quite cold, and it a any
posed that, the wretched man committed the dread'
ful deed in a it of temporary insanity. He was
abmsl thirty gee years ninny, and was highly res
pected by bra employen, and all who knew bet.
He leaves a ink and two children to mourn over
hit untimely end. A coroner'. pry was bold
Over the body, and a verdict in accordance with
the Gets rendered.
Roaasav —We learn qrw a telegraphic des
patch, received in Mis city, that the library of the
Washington College, was broken into oath° aught
of the twentieth by spate thieves, and robbed of a
Large number of valuable books_ It is sopposed
that the robbers came to Pittsburgh, as a man with
a large number of bo. ha was wen catalog . to town
alter the robbery was committed.
